Output 8248fc5cfa2c29fbe9f38b98716cc71c02738b27c187d4053eba7a1fa4c17a1b:0

value
19737452
script pubkey
OP_0 OP_PUSHBYTES_20 e292405fee7185ea5a29a14b7d22e24ad09fb38b
address
bc1qu2fyqhlwwxz75k3f599h6ghzftgflvutj46h3f
transaction
8248fc5cfa2c29fbe9f38b98716cc71c02738b27c187d4053eba7a1fa4c17a1b
confirmations
244151
spent
true